Ellipsys Commercial Technology Group Makes Impactful Debut at InfoComm 2023

Written by Rob Stott

June 20, 2023

The full scope of Nationwide Marketing Group’s “Drive to 1,000” custom integration division came into full view during InfoComm 2023, the commercial audio/video conference that unfolded in Orlando last week. There, Ellipsys Commercial Technology Group made a major splash by officially debuting and welcoming its charter members and vendor partners into the group.

Ellipsys, which joins a CI network that includes Oasys Residential Technology Group and Azione Unlimited, aims to fill a void in the commercial integrator industry by providing emerging systems integrators with a way to grow their businesses through education, networking, unmatched vendor programs and world-class business summits.

Earlier this year, Nationwide tapped industry veteran Chris Whitley to lead the commercial initiative. Whitley, Nationwide’s executive director of commercial integration, brings more than 25 years of experience to the table, most of which has been spent establishing and growing commercial integration buying groups.

“We are thrilled to have Chris on the team and leading the charge around Ellipsys,” said Nationwide Marketing Group COO Dean Sottile. “His diverse background and previous work experience leading buying groups made him the perfect fit for this new commercial initiative. He understands where the opportunities exist in this industry and can provide a clear action plan that he will execute to the benefit of both integrators and vendors.”

The week at InfoComm was a busy one for Whitley and Ellipsys. In addition to introducing the industry to the new group, the team had several dozen meetings with potential vendor partners and new members.

“InfoComm provided a great platform for us to launch Ellipsys and connect with industry partners,” Whitley says. “I am excited about the opportunity ahead of us as we build an ecosystem that will enable our members to invest in the necessary pillars for success: their people, their processes and their partnerships. We exist to provide members with a way to connect, collaborate and transform their businesses. That philosophy, coupled with the tremendous business and financial services programs available through Nationwide, positions Ellipsys as one of the most compelling offerings in the commercial space.”
